Yes, you are right. I found out th...Thanks Robert. <br />Yes, you are right. I found out that using the Dragon software is much more time consuming when I tested it against manual (listen, memorise, pause and type) process.<br /> Bought the Dragon Naturally Speaking Version 12, trained my voice, echoed (re-recorded) the interview in my own voice, and then used software, it transcribed well, but with substantial errors, had to do a lot of correcting, etc.<br />In the end i found that it took 30% longer using the software compared to manual process. I have decided to transcribe manually. It is time consuming, but i guess that is just part of the process. <br />I was looking for smarter way of working. I don't know of anything that works dramatically better and interviews are always a challenge on the basis that the interviewee may speak quickly, quietly, with an accent, etc. Typically, these are the kinds of things that translation software finds difficult. One trick I tried was was to relisten to the original audio in my headphones and stop every sentence or two to re-say what I'd just heard. If you train the software to know your voice and you speak slowly and clearly enough then you can make reasonable progress. I was never very clear if this made enough of a time saving over straight transcription.
